REDWOOD CITY, CA – August 26, 2008 – Hudson Entertainment, the North
American publishing arm of Hudson Soft, today announced that it is
bringing its classic TurboGrafx-16
Alien Crush series to WiiWare on the Wii with Alien Crush Returns.

Alien Crush Returns is a sci-fi pinball game based on the classic
TurboGrafx-16 Alien Crush series from Hudson Entertainment.  In
extraordinary pinball fashion, the game offers gameplay spanning two
screens, providing players a lot of real estate to rack up points,
multipliers, and bonuses. The game is played across multiple boards,
all of which feature an eerie alien landscape and enemies that try to
prevent pinball perfection.

REDWOOD CITY, CA – August 26, 2008 – Hudson Entertainment, the North
American publishing arm for HUDSON SOFT, today announced that they are
releasing Bomberman Blast, an all-new Bomberman for digital download
for WiiWare on the Wii. Retaining the classic features Bomberman fans
have come to love such as online multiplayer battles and numerous
arenas,  Bomberman Blast also incorporates new gameplay elements,
including the use of Mii support and 8-person online multiplayer – the
first time for Bomberman on Wii!

Burlingame, Calif., August 26, 2008 – Natsume, a worldwide developer
and publisher of family-oriented video games, announced today that
Harvest Moon: Island of Happiness for the Nintendo DS has officially
shipped, marking Natsume’s ten year commemorative anniversary
celebration for the popular Harvest Moon series. Harvest Moon: Island
of Happiness is rated E for Everyone by the ESRB and will retail for
$29.99.
